Route overview
In this lesson, we explore how users access applications by leveraging OpenShift Routes. OpenShift Routes serve as a gateway, exposing internal Services to external users via a specified hostname.
Imagine a user who needs to access an application. The user opens a device—be it a computer, tablet, or mobile—and navigates to a URL. This URL either directs the user to an error page or to the live application, depending on whether the required Service is correctly exposed.
Insight
A Route in OpenShift is analogous to a load balancer in Kubernetes. It manages and directs incoming traffic, allowing users to access the application using an IP address, hostname, or any DNS name of your choice.
Within OpenShift, a Route exposes a Service running on the platform to a specific hostname. For instance, you can configure a Route to expose a Service at "www.example.com" or "www.google.com". In a hypothetical scenario where Google is hosted on OpenShift, its underlying Pods (or containers) would be managed by a Service that the Route externally exposes.
From a Kubernetes perspective, setting up a Route mirrors configuring a load balancer. Both systems ensure that external requests are properly routed to the internal Service, making applications accessible using various DNS names or IP addresses.
